About The Position

At CAPSA, we are committed to building safe, empowering spaces for survivors of domestic violence, sexual assault, and their families. Our on-site Children's Center serves a dual purpose: it provides trauma-informed care for the children of CAPSA clients receiving services-and it also supports CAPSA staff by operating as an employee daycare. We're looking for a dependable, caring individual to join our Children's Center team. This position is ideal for someone who loves working with kids, is grounded in compassion, and understands how to support children in a calm, safe, and structured environment.
